Nagpur, Dec 13: Senior BJP leader and former Deputy Chief Minister of Maharshtra Gopinath Munde today demanded a CBI probe into the incidents at Kankvali, where the house of opposition leader in the legislative assembly, Narayan Rane of Shiv Sena was torched following killing of NCP leader Satyavijay Bhise on November 23. Initiating a short discussion under rule 101 in the state assembly here, Munde alleged that NCP had become a den of Mafia gang and Bhise was done to death by criminals hired by NCP itself and not by Shiv Sena workers as claimed by the ruling Congress-NCP alliance. Munde also demanded that top police officials, who were allegedly ‘part of the violent act and arson’ should be booked for the crime and be arrested immediately. The whole incident, including torching of Rane's house, petrol pump and other property, lasted for three hours and police simply played the role of onlookers, he said.
Munde asked as to why police did not use force like lathicharge, bursting of teargas shells or firing to disperse the angry crowd.

“It was a pre-planned conspiracy of agitators in nexus with police,” Munde said.
He also questioned the wisdom of concerned police officials for imposing a ban of entry of Rane when he tried to visit his own home after the incident.
